A Blind Watermarking Algorithm of 3D Mesh Model for Rapid Prototyping System Application

RP 시스템 적용을 위한 3차원 메쉬 모델의 블라인드 워터마킹

  • 최기철 (상명대학교 디지털저작권보호연구센터)
  • Published : 2007.12.31

Abstract

In this paper, we proposed a blind watermarking algorithm to apply to the rapid prototyping system. The 3D mesh model is used in the step of the CAD modeling before the making of the prototype system of the rapid prototyping system. STL type mesh modeling which is used in this system reduces the error of the system and improves the accuracy of the system. In the step of the CAD modeling, some transformations which do not change the model accuracy are used, but some transformations which change the model accuracy are not used because the mesh model error is related to the accuracy of the prototype system. Most watermarking algorithms embedded a specific random noise as the watermark information into the model. These kinds of the algorithms are not proper to the 3D model watermarking. The proposed algorithm can be used for the accurate prototyping system because it does not change the model after the watermark embedding This means it can be used for the copyright marking and the data integrity.

본 논문에서는 쾌속조형시스템(Rapid Prototyping System)에 적용 가능한 블라인드 워터마킹 알고리즘을 제안한다. 3차원 메쉬 모델은 쾌속조형시스템의 시제품 제작 전 단계인 CAD 모델링 단계에서 사용된다. STL 형태의 메쉬 모델을 이용하여 제작할 시제품의 오류를 확인하고 수정하여 정밀도를 높이고 데이터의 오류를 줄인다. 모델링 단계의 메쉬 모델 오류는 시제품의 정밀도와 직접 연결되기 때문에 시제품 제작 전 단계에서는 이동, 회전과 같은 모델의 형태를 변형시키지 않는 변환은 사용하지만 데시메이션, 평활화 등의 변환은 사용되지 않는다. 기존의 대부분 워터마킹 알고리즘은 모델에 특정 노이즈를 추가하는 방법으로 워터마크 정보를 표현한다. 이런 알고리즘은 쾌속조형시스템에 사용할 경우 시제품의 정밀도를 저하시키기 때문에 사용이 극히 제한적이다. 제안한 알고리즘은 워터마크 삽입 전후 모델의 형태가 변하지 않으며 쾌속조형시스템과 같은 고정밀도를 요구하는 기계공학 분야에서 제작자 정보의 표현, 데이터의 무결성 인증 등 목적으로 사용할 수 있으며, 가상현실 등 다른 분야에서는 정보은닉 용도로도 사용할 수 있다.

Keywords

References

  1. 이공래, 황정태, STEPI 한국기술정책연구원, '다분야 기술융합의 혁신시스템 특성분석,' 정책연구 2005-7. 00. 88-114
  2. 정두수, 피혁연구소 생산자동화팀, PR Service
  3. Min-Su Kim, Jae-Won Cho, Remy Prost, HoYoul Jung, 'A Blind Watermarking for 3D Mesh Sequence Using Temporal Wavelet Transform of Vertex Norm', The Journal of The Korean Institute of Communication sciences, 2007. 1. 8, pp. 256-257
  4. Thou Xun, MasterThesis, departtrent of Mathematical Zhejiang University, china, '三緯幾何模型字 水印技術&算法硏究,' 2002.2
  5. R. ailiuchi, H. Msxla, and M. Aono, 'Watemmking Three Dimensional Polygonal Mxlels,' Proceedings of the ACM Multimedia '97, Seattle, Washington, USA, November 1997, pp. 261-272
  6. Chang min Chou, and an Chang Tseng. 'Techndogies for 3D Model Watenrnrking: A Smvey,' International Journal of computer Science and Network Security, Vol.7 No.2. February 2007
  7. O. Benedens, 'Two High Capacity Methods for Embedding Public Watermarks into 3D Polygonal Models,' Proceedings of the Multimedia and Security-Workshop at ACM Multimedia 99, Orlando, Florida, 1999. pp 95-99
  8. O. Benedens, 'Watermarking of 3D Polygon Based Models with Robustness against Mesh Simplification'. Proceedings of SPIE: Security and Watermarking of Multimedia Contents, 1999, Vol. 3657, pp. 329-340
  9. S. Toub, A. Healy, 'Efficient Mesh Licensing,' Computer Science 276r, Havard University, May 2001
  10. E. Praun, H. Hoppe and A. Finkelstein, 'Robust Mesh Watermarking,' SIGGRAPH Proceeding, 1999, pp. 69-76
  11. 천인국, 김기석, '3차원 기하학적 형상인 STL의 디지털 워터마킹 방법' 대한민국특허청 공개특허 10-2004-0002250, 공개일자 2004.1.7
  12. 김선형, '3차원형상 워터마킹의 삽입 및 추출,' 대한민국특허청 공개특허 10-2004-0003185, 공개일자 2004.1.13
  13. 양동열, 안동규, 신보성, 이상호, '선형 열절단 시스템을 이용한 가변 적층 쾌속조형방법 및 쾌속조형장치,' 출원번호2001-72938, 등록 10-0384135 일본 Patent-2005-Vol.003-0017
  14. http://www.3dsystems.com
  15. http://meshlab.sourceforge.net
  16. Cui Jizhe, CPRI, Sangmyung University, 'A Semi-fragile Watermarking Algorithm of 3D Mesh Model for Rapid Prototyping System Application,' Korea Institute of Information Security & Cryptology, 2007